Homeopathic Solutions

Homeopathy can be very useful when travelling with children, especially as the pills are easy to administer and are 100% natural and safe to take.  The remedies can be very fast acting which can be a great comfort when you have a screaming infant on your hands.

The most common remedy recommended when abroad is Pulsatilla, especially if your child is tearful, very clingy and thirstless. This remedy is effective for a whole host of ailments from fevers to earaches. However, if your child has a fever and is especially hot and red, then Belladonna can help aid the fever to come to its natural conclusion.

For those who suffer from travel sickness then Arg-Nit can be very useful where there is nausea and vomiting with nervous agitation, or Cocculus if there is nausea and retching with salivation and dizziness.

For a bout of food poisoning, taking AsAlb works well for most cases, whatever the associated bug or bacteria. For those going on long plane journeys then a combination of Arnica, Cocculus and Gelsenium are good to take to counter-act the effects of jet lag. To further limit the symptoms please ensure your child drinks plenty of water throughout the flight. A child who suffers from painful popping of ears on take-off should take some Silica to relieve the pressure.
